The remains of a former commercial building at Route 309 and Blackman Street in Wilkes-Barre Township are seen on Friday afternoon. The site is being cleared to make way for a Burger King restaurant. A new Turkey Hill project is planned for the opposite side of Blackman Street, which will include a gas station, convenience store, restaurant and car wash.
